Born in Matinecock, Long Island, Nassau, New York on 5 Jun 1797 to Daniel Wright and PHEBE BENNETT. Mary Wright married James Hyde and had 7 children. She passed away on 24 May 1865 in 390 Hudson Avenue, 11th Ward, Brooklyn, New York, United States.
